#E97CDD Hex Color Code

#E97CDD

The Hexadecimal Color #E97CDD is a contrast shade of Violet. #E97CDD RGB value is rgb(233, 124, 221). RGB Color Model of #E97CDD consists of 91% red, 48% green and 86% blue. HSL color Mode of #E97CDD has 307°(degrees) Hue, 71% Saturation and 70% Lightness. #E97CDD color has an wavelength of 426.7037n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#E97CDD is #FF99FF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#E97CDD is #E7D. The Closest Color to #E97CDD is #EE82EE. Official Name of #E97CDD Hex Code is Orchid.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#E97CDD is 0 Cyan 47 Magenta 5 Yellow 9 Black and #E97CDD CMY is 0, 47, 5.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#E97CDD is hsl(307,71,70,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(307, 47, 91).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#E97CDD is 53.86, 36.96, 72.69.
Hex8 Value of #E97CDD is #E97CDDFF. Decimal Value of #E97CDD is 15301853 and Octal Value of #E97CDD is 72276335. Binary Value of #E97CDD is 11101001, 1111100, 11011101 and Android of #E97CDD is 4293491933 / 0xffe97cdd.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#E97CDD is 0.329, 0.226, 0.226 and YIQ Color Space of #E97CDD is 167.649, 33.787, 53.2399.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#E97CDD is 43.54, 25.29, 72.15.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#E97CDD is 67.25, 54.93, -31.27.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#E97CDD is 67.25, 54.97, -57.52.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#E97CDD is 67.25, 63.21, 330.35. Hunter Lab variable of #E97CDD is 60.79, 51.75, -28.33.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#E97CDD

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
